Excerpt from Shakespeare, the Seer the Interpreter: The Address Delivered Before the St. George's Society of Toronto, in the Cathedral Church of St. James, April the 23rd, 1864
It is now between three and four hundred years ago that Copernicus lived, that Columbus lived. It is exactly three hundred years since Galileo lived it is almost that since Raleigh coasted and gave name to the Virginian shore; it is a little more than that since Cartier ascended the St. Lawrence, and since Balboa.
